strawberry_pickingThe seeds of the Eden Alternative are planted in the people's hearts. It is, after all, with our hearts, rather than our eyes, that we see what is essential in this world.  Just as an organic gardener understands that the garden will not grow without the gardener, so it is with your Eden garden.  You are organizational gardeners.  Your gardens will not grow without your hard work.  The Eden Home Office and many of our Registered Homes have developed tools to help you grow a beautiful garden.  A wise gardener will use these tools to make a bountiful harvest.  As you grow your own garden, we encourage you to share the lessons and tools that you have developed with other Eden gardeners.

picture1From Woodside Village
doc Abiders Training Packet
Abiders are a volunteer group associated with Valley Memorial Homes.  The group is committed to providing quality spiritual care at the End of Life for the residents of Woodside Village, especially when there are no family members or friends available to be present when a resident is near death.

From Woodside Village
End of Life Pathway
The End of Life Pathway was developed to coincide with the Mission of our facility which is to provide quality care and services from a Christian perspective to the people we serve.  We believe that same quality and care needs to be given at the end of life.

picture1From Woodside Village
Welcoming New Staff -from an Elder view point
Iona, a resident at Woodside Village, has been an instrumental part of training new employees of the nursing home.  The following statements and thoughts came from Iona and reflect her opinion of what she likes to share with new employees.
